Ronald Van Gelderen (aka Kid Viscious) first came to my attention with his
excellent (IMO) remix of 'Punk' by Ferry Corsten. His first full release under his own
name, 'Proceed' was a massive hit and hammered all over the world by anyone into their
quality trance. Fans should also check out 'Indecisive' under his Electrobics alias which
is a stunning bit of progressive trance (check my Sunset To Sunrise mix where this is
featured on the Sunset cd).
Anyway back to the tune. This to me is how trance should be - full on driving
beats and synths and perfect for mid to end of any trance set. The breakdown drops with
a small vocal snippet 'All it takes...' and then the wicked reversed style synth riff
kicks in and the crowd go honey nut loopy. Massive power chords bring the riff in and
the beats and bass kick in big time. If you haven't heard this yet, don't worry and
you can bet your life it will be hammered all over club land once it sees a full release.
Absolutely essential and one which will be sitting at the front of the box for many months
to come.
